The Development of CNC Machines in India

The use of CNC machines in India go back to the late 20th century when they were initially presented to enhance accuracy and automation in producing processes. At first, these machines were limited to large-scale industries because of their high price and complex procedure. However, with technological improvements and decreasing prices, CNC machines have actually come to be much more obtainable to little and medium-sized ventures (SMEs) across various sectors.

Overcoming Challenges in Adoption

Despite the countless benefits that CNC machines supply, there are still challenges that demand to be resolved for prevalent adoption throughout all markets. One major obstacle is the absence of proficient drivers who can configure and run these advanced machines efficiently. Additionally, preliminary investment costs can be prohibitive for smaller companies looking to update their equipment.

Addressing the Abilities Gap

To get over the abilities void concern, it is necessary for training programs to be created that focus on training drivers exactly how to configure and troubleshoot CNC machines. By buying labor force development campaigns, makers can guarantee that they have a proficient workforce capable of making best use of the potential of these technologies.
